The Magic Keyboard for the 12.9-inch iPad Pro makes the entire setup weigh 3-lbs. The version for the 11-inch iPad Pro weighs about 1.3lbs, making the final weight 2.3lbs. The Magic Keyboard cover adds weight as well as thickness, though. The M1 MacBook Air is about 2.8lbs, while the 12.9-inch iPad Pro is 1.4lbs, and the 11-inch iPad Pro is 1lb. In terms of weight, the iPad Pro is lighter. If you get the Magic Keyboard cover with the iPad Pro, though, the thickness of each device is exactly the same. There’s also a 0.4-inch difference in thickness-the MacBook Air is 0.6 inches thick, while the iPad Pro is 0.2 inches thick. But it’s only a 0.4-inch size difference. The 13.3-inch MacBook Air is technically larger than the 12.9-inch iPad Pro. The current iPad Pro comes in 11 inches or 12.9 inches. The M1 MacBook Air only comes in one size: 13.3 inches. The M1 MacBook Air comes with 256GB, 512GB, 1TB, or 2TB, depending on which configuration you get. The iPad Pro starts smaller at 128GB but you can also get models with 256GB, 512GB, 1TB, and even 2TB. The devices also very similar storage capacity. You can get the laptop with a seven-core or an eight-core GPU.Īs expected, both the MacBook Air and the iPad Pro also offer similar amounts of RAM, either 8GB or 16GB depending on your chosen configuration. The MacBook Air also comes with an eight-core CPU but offers four efficiency cores.
